What Is a Base64 to PDF Converter?
An online Base64 to PDF Converter is a convenient tool that changes Base64-encoded data back into a standard PDF document. Base64 is commonly used to represent binary information as text, allowing files to be base64 to pdf converter transferred through APIs, websites, databases, and other systems that work with text-based data. When a PDF is converted into Base64, the result appears as a long string of characters rather than a normal document. A converter reverses this process by decoding the string and reconstructing the original PDF file, making the document accessible again.
How Does Base64 to PDF Conversion Work?
The conversion process is based on decoding the Base64 string into its original binary data. When a user provides valid Base64 content, the converter reads the encoded characters and translates them back into bytes. These bytes contain the information required to recreate the PDF. Once the data has been decoded correctly, it can be saved as a PDF file and opened with a standard PDF reader. Some Base64 strings may include a data prefix identifying the content as a PDF, while others contain only the encoded portion of the document.

Common Uses of Base64 to PDF Conversion
Base64-encoded PDF data is used in many digital applications. For example, an API might return an invoice, report, certificate, receipt, or form as Base64 rather than as a direct file attachment. Developers can decode this information to create a normal PDF for viewing or storage. Base64 conversion can also be helpful when troubleshooting document-generation systems and verifying that encoded data has been transmitted correctly. Users should ensure that the complete Base64 string is provided, because missing or modified characters can result in an invalid or damaged PDF.
